How Important Are Spices in Authentic Indian Food?
Spices are the backbone of Indian cuisine.
An authentic indian food wollongong experience uses whole spices like cumin, cardamom, turmeric, and garam masala in the right balance. It’s not about making food overly spicy, but about creating depth and aroma.
You’ll notice:
- Layers of flavour, not just heat
- Freshly ground spices instead of pre-mixed powders
- Consistency in taste across dishes

Do Authentic Indian Restaurants Use Traditional Cooking Methods?
Yes, and it makes a big difference.
Many authentic indian restaurants in wollongong use traditional cooking techniques such as:
- Tandoor (clay oven) for naan and kebabs
- Slow-cooking curries for deeper flavour
- Handcrafted breads made fresh to order
These methods enhance both taste and texture, giving you that “home-style” feel even when dining out.
